Reactive Spark Plasma Sintering of Si3N4 Based Composites
Abstract:
Si3N4 based composites containing different amounts of SiC and SiAlON were produced by reactive spark plasma sintering of Si3N4, SiO2 and C black. Y2O3 and AlN were added as sintering additives. The SPS process was carried out at sintering temperature of 1650 0C for 5 min with uniaxial pressure of 40 MPa in a nitrogen atmosphere.The mechanic properties and morphology of Si3N4 ceramic composite were determined. Microstructures of the sintered samples were observed by SEM images and phase compositions were analysed by XRD.
